According to TikToker ohio_smokeshow, the cable scam goes like this—a person who has access to your home leaves behind what seems like a harmless object. In this case, a smartphone charger and a charging block. It could be an ‘OMG’ cable, named after what victims say when they realize they’ve been hacked. It’s designed to gain remote access to your network.
She explains, “People are weird, and they do weird s**t.” Tiktoker ohio_smokeshow recommends throwing charging cables and blocks away immediately if your date left it behind. “Don’t ask questions,” she says.
